The video explores the Maras region in Peru, known for its ancient salt evaporation ponds. Located near Cuzco, these ponds have been used since Inca times. The video details the process of salt extraction, which involves directing salty water from a subterranean stream into terraced ponds. The cooperative system, believed to be established by the Incas, ensures proper maintenance and salt harvesting. The salt varies in color and is available for sale. The community plays a crucial role in managing the ponds, with new families receiving ponds based on size and availability.
